Court of Appeals of the State of Georgia ATLANTA,____________________ January 13, 2025 The Court of Appeals hereby passes the following order: A25A0961. RASHEEDA MCCULLOUGH v. THE STATE OF GEORGIA.

Rasheeda McCullough appeals directly to this Court from the trial court’s order dismissing her petition for habeas corpus. Under our Constitution, the Supreme Court of Georgia has exclusive appellate jurisdiction over all cases involving habeas corpus.

See Ga. Const. 1983, Art. VI, Sec. VI, Par. III (4). Accordingly, we hereby TRANSFER this case to the Supreme Court for disposition.
